Study Notes

Acetaminophen with Codeine

  • Brand name: Tylenol with codeine
  • Classification: Opioid combination
  • Function: Analgesic medication for pain relief

Atenolol

  • Brand name: Tenormin
  • Classification: Beta-blocker
  • Use: Treatment of hypertension (high blood pressure)

Benzonatate

  • Brand name: Tessalon perles
  • Classification: Antitussive
  • Purpose: Cough relief

Budesonide

  • Brand name: Rhinocort AQ
  • Classification: Corticosteroid
  • Indication: Management of asthma symptoms

Budesonide-Formoterol

  • Brand name: Symbicort
  • Classification: Corticosteroid/B2-agonist combination
  • Use: Asthma management

Buprenorphine & Naloxone

  • Brand name: Suboxone
  • Classification: Opioid agonist/antagonist
  • Function: Treatment of opioid dependence

Carisoprodol

  • Brand name: Soma
  • Classification: Muscle relaxant
  • Purpose: Relief of muscle spasms

Chlorpheniramine-Hydrocodone

  • Brand name: Tussionex
  • Classification: Antihistamine-antitussive combination
  • Use: Relief of upper respiratory symptoms

Cyclosporine

  • Brand name: Restasis
  • Classification: Calcineurin inhibitor immunosuppressant
  • Indication: Treatment of ocular dryness

Diazepam

  • Brand name: Valium
  • Classification: Benzodiazepine
  • Use: Management of anxiety

Doxycycline Hyclate

  • Brand name: Vibramycin
  • Classification: Tetracycline antibiotic
  • Indication: Treatment of bacterial infections

Eletriptan

  • Brand name: Not provided
  • Classification: Triptan
  • Function: Treatment of migraine headaches

Alfuzosin

  • Brand name: Uroxatral
  • Classification: Alpha-blocker
  • Indication: Management of ben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H)

Enalapril

  • Brand name: Vasotec
  • Classification: ACE inhibitor
  • Use: Treatment of hypertension

Ergocalciferol

  • Brand name: Vitamin D2
  • Function: Aids in absorption and use of calcium and phosphate

Estradiol

  • Brand name: Vagifem
  • Classification: Estrogen
  • Use: Treatment of vulvovaginal atrophy

Ezetimibe-Simvastatin

  • Brand name: Vytorin
  • Classification: HMG-CoA reductase inhibitor combination
  • Indication: Management of hypercholesterolemia (high cholesterol)

Fenofibrate

  • Brand name: Tricor
  • Classification: Fibrate
  • Indication: Treatment of hyperlipidemia (high lipid levels)

Hydrocodone & Acetaminophen

  • Brand name: Vicodin (also Norco)
  • Classification: Opioid combination
  • Function: Analgesic for pain relief

Atomoxetine HCL

  • Brand name: Strattera
  • Classification: Nor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or
  • Indication: Treatment of ADHD (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der)
